When should I start working with a CPA in Midtown Phoenix?

The best time to engage a CPA in Midtown Phoenix is at the beginning of your tax year — January or February — not during tax season. This allows time for entity restructuring, retirement plan setup, estimated tax adjustments, and income timing strategies that must be implemented before year-end. For Midtown Phoenix business owners, mid-year check-ins (July–August) are critical for projecting annual income and making Q3/Q4 adjustments. What documents do I need for my CPA near 85013?

Gather these before your appointment: W-2s and 1099s (all types), prior year tax return, business income/expense records, mortgage interest statement (Form 1098), property tax records, investment statements (1099-B, 1099-DIV), health insurance forms (1095-A/B/C), charitable donation receipts, business mileage log, and home office measurements. For Midtown Phoenix residents, also bring AZ state-specific forms. How is a CPA different from an enrolled agent in Midtown Phoenix?

Both CPAs and Enrolled Agents (EAs) can represent taxpayers before the IRS, but their training differs significantly. CPAs complete broad accounting education covering auditing, financial reporting, and business law in addition to taxation. EAs specialize exclusively in tax through the IRS Special Enrollment Examination. For Midtown Phoenix business owners who need both tax strategy and financial oversight — such as cash flow management, financial statements, and entity structuring — a CPA in 85013 typically provides more comprehensive service.

What is the difference between a CPA and a tax preparer in Midtown Phoenix?

A CPA (Certified Public Accountant) holds a state license requiring 150 credit hours of education, passing the Uniform CPA Exam, and ongoing continuing education. A tax preparer may have minimal credentials — only a PTIN is required. In Midtown Phoenix, this distinction matters: CPAs can represent you before the IRS in audits, provide attestation services, and offer year-round strategic tax planning. Are CPA fees tax-deductible in Midtown Phoenix?

Yes — CPA fees related to business tax preparation and advisory are fully deductible as a business expense under IRC §162. For Midtown Phoenix business owners, this includes tax planning, bookkeeping, entity structuring, and audit representation. Personal tax preparation fees are no longer deductible for W-2 employees after the 2017 Tax Cuts and Jobs Act, but self-employed individuals and business owners in Midtown Phoenix can still deduct them on Schedule C.
